Stephen Holmes, the CEO of hospitality company Wyndham Worldwide, believes that the impact of accommodation-sharing platform Airbnb on the hotel sector has been overexaggerated. When it comes to the question as to whether Airbnb has been the biggest factor behind the recent consolidation within the global hotel sector, Holmes suggests that a more important factor has been the growth of online travel agents like booking.com and Expedia.
